So I looked and it looks like it does, but I can't find the screw. The firing pin spring is much shorter than the spring on the open gun.

The short firing pin is the giveaway - you do have that feature.

The screw is inside the firing pin channel (the firing pin runs through it). Use a T handled 1/8" allen wrench if you wish to remove it.

Some advice: DO NOT REMOVE THE BREACH FACE...... there is no reason to, even for cleaning.... if its not broke don't fix it. More of the hollow screws that secure the breach face have been screwed up by over tightening the screw, "just checking" to make sure its snug, and/or taking it off for "just giving it a thorough cleaning". Its supposed be at a certain light torque, which requires a torque wrench in inch/pounds. It's really not supposed to be a serviceable part, except for a caliber change, etc. If its not rattling or moving around, just leave it alone. ;)
